lumis.service.newsletter
Interface ICategoryDao

Package class diagram package ICategoryDao
All Known Implementing Classes:
CategoryDaoHib

public interface ICategoryDao

Since:
4.0.8

Method Summary
 void addOrUpdate(Category bean, ITransaction transaction)
           
 boolean delete(java.lang.String id, ITransaction transaction)
           
 Category get(java.lang.String id, ITransaction transaction)
           
 java.util.List<java.lang.String> getCategoryContentItemIds(java.util.Locale locale, Category category, java.util.Date startDateTime, ITransaction transaction)
           
 

Method Detail

addOrUpdate

void addOrUpdate(Category bean,
                 ITransaction transaction)
                 throws PortalException
Parameters:
bean -
transaction -
Throws:
PortalException
Since:
4.0.8

delete

boolean delete(java.lang.String id,
               ITransaction transaction)
               throws PortalException
Parameters:
id -
transaction -
Returns:
Throws:
PortalException
Since:
4.0.8

get

Category get(java.lang.String id,
             ITransaction transaction)
             throws PortalObjectNotFoundException,
                    PortalException
Parameters:
id -
transaction -
Returns:
Throws:
PortalObjectNotFoundException
PortalException
Since:
4.0.8

getCategoryContentItemIds

java.util.List<java.lang.String> getCategoryContentItemIds(java.util.Locale locale,
                                                           Category category,
                                                           java.util.Date startDateTime,
                                                           ITransaction transaction)
                                                           throws PortalException
Parameters:
category -
startDateTime -
transaction -
Returns:
Throws:
PortalException
Since:
4.0.8


Lumisportal  6.1.0.111014 - Copyright © 2001-2007, Lumis. All Rights Reserved.